MAMBRETTI v. POUGHKEEPSIE GALLERIA COMPANY


288 A.D.2d 443 (2001)

732 N.Y.S.2d 909

JOHN MAMBRETTI et al., Respondents, v. POUGHKEEPSIE GALLERIA COMPANY, Appellant.

Appellate Division of the Supreme Court of the State of New York, Second Department.

Decided November 26, 2001.


Ordered that the order is reversed, on the law, without costs or disbursements, the motion is granted, the cross motion is denied, and the complaint is dismissed.
